Highlights
- President: Harry Truman
Vice President: Alben Barkley
- Headlines
- January 17th - Brink's robbery in Boston; almost $3 million stolen
- January 31st - Truman orders development of hydrogen bomb
- May 9th - Robert Schuman proposes Schuman Plan to pool European coal and steel
- June 25th - Korean War begins when North Korean Communist forces invade South Korea
- November 1st - Assassination attempt on President Truman by Puerto Rican nationalists

- Prices
- House $14,500.00
- Car $1,750.00
- Milk $.82
- Gas $.20
- Bread $.14
- Postage Stamp $0.03
- Avg Income $3,216.00
- Academy Award Winners
- Best Picture: All About Eve - Directed By Joseph L Mankiewicz
- Best Actor: Jose Ferrer - Cyrano De Bergerac
- Best Actress: Judy Holliday - Born Yesterday
- Sports Headlines
- National League wins Baseball's All Star Game
- New York wins the World Series in 4 straight games over Philadelphia
- Browns defeat the Rams 30-28 to win the Football Title
- Heavyweight Champ Ezzard Charles defeats Joe Louis in 15 rounds in an attempted comeback in New York
